Reputation is everything. Just as Spielberg regretted Jaws for fueling fear of sharks, AI faces its own PR challenge—caught between utopian optimism and dystopian paranoia. But AI isn’t the disruptor—poor strategy is. Misaligned communication, rushed implementation, and lack of oversight are the real barriers to success. That was the focus of AI’s PR Challenge: Strategies to Overcome the Myths and Misconceptions, a panel at Tech Show London 2025, moderated by our MADTech Practice Director, Alex Humphries-French. Our expert panel tackled the biggest AI misconceptions, highlighting why businesses must prioritise strategic adoption, upskilling, and ethical implementation. Key takeaways: 🔹 AI won’t take jobs, but strategic reskilling is critical. As Thomas Laranjo (Mediaplus UK / Behave) put it, “We’re in a moment of radical transformation, not optimisation. We’re going to need budgets to re-educate, re-skill ourselves and our workforces.” 🔹 AI ethics requires collective action. Lauren Hendry Parsons (ExpressVPN) emphasised that “AI can be ethical—but it needs to be a choice that it happens. It can’t be achieved alone. Not by companies, not by regulators, and not by individuals. It needs to happen on a systemic level.” 🔹 AI is a tool, not a replacement for human expertise. Supriya Dev-Purkaystha (She/Her) (Microsoft) explained, “We’re not creating AI to replace humans; these tools are meant to enable us to do more. AI is supporting us when making important decisions, ensuring we make the right decision.” She added, “And for this reason, it’s important that the teams building and developing AI are diverse in their skills and lived experiences.” 🔹 Transparency and accountability are key. Lauren stressed that “Be honest about how you’re using the technology and the data. Own up to it—make it clear that when people engage with AI, this is what they’re getting. If things don’t go to plan, be accountable. That’s the key to winning trust.” A huge thank you to Lauren Hendry Parsons, VP of Communications & Advocacy at ExpressVPN, Supriya Dev-Purkaystha (She/Her), Head of Media and Ad Tech Solutions, UK at Microsoft, and Thomas Laranjo, CEO of Mediaplus UK / Behave for their insights. Over the weekend, US Managing Director Mary Cirincione hosted Propeller Group’s signature ‘Industry Journalists Tell All’ session - a frank, no-holds-barred conversation - for the SXSW community at #UKHouse. 🎤 Mary was joined on stage by Kathryn Lundstrom from ADWEEK and Kerry Flynn from Axios for a ‘tough truths,’ deep dive exploration of what today’s media landscape really looks like, and how we can better serve our industry, including: 📌 What trade and biz journalists are actively looking for - Strong expertise, an education-first mindset and vocal sources with distinct perspectives. 📌 The role of PR + comms - As the bridge between businesses and media, comms professionals are key to shaping meaningful conversations. 📌 Why amplification is critical - Securing coverage is just the first step; ensuring it reaches the right audience, at scale, drives meaningful impact. #UKatSXSW #SXSW #UKCreativity

Celebrating 20 Years of the WACL Talent Awards 🎉 Wednesday night marked the 20th anniversary of the WACL Talent Awards, an initiative dedicated to supporting the next generation of women in leadership. This year, 28 future leaders were awarded bursaries of up to £1,500 each to invest in training that will shape their careers. We are proud of our Chief Client Officer, Rose Bentley, for her role on the Talent Awards committee, helping to deliver this incredible initiative. Founded in 1923, WACL (Women in Advertising & Communications Leadership ), is a group of senior women in marketing, media, and communications working towards gender equality in leadership through support, advocacy and initiatives like these awards. It was an inspiring evening celebrating talent, ambition, and the future of female leadership. 📸 Photography by Bronac McNeill #WACLTalentAwards #WomenInLeadership #Talent #WACL
